The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in England requiring ERwin sk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 20 May 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
20 May 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 534 416 482
Rank change year-on-year -118 +66 +90
Contract jobs citing ERwin 48 53 51
As % of all contract jobs in England 0.12% 0.22% 0.14%
As % of the Development Applications category 0.97% 1.58% 1.20%
Number of daily rates quoted 33 39 42
10th Percentile £358 £402 £425
25th Percentile £440 £459 £576
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£540 £550 £700
Median % change year-on-year -1.82% -21.43% -3.45%
75th Percentile £650 £600 £738
90th Percentile £735 £678 £775
UK median daily rate £545 £525 £700
% change year-on-year +3.81% -25.00% -
